the straight line L, has equation y=3x-4 The straight line 1, in perpendicular to L, and passes through the point (9.5) Find an

equation of line L

Given:

The equation of given line is

y=3x-4

A line is perpendicular to the given line and passes through the point (9,5).

To find:

The equation of the perpendicular line.

Solution:

We have,

y=3x-4

On comparing this equation with slope intercept form y=mx+b, we get

m=3

It means, the slope of the given line is 3.

The product of slopes of two perpendicular lines is -1.

m\times m_1=-1

3\times m_1=-1

m_1=-\dfrac{1}{3}

Point slope form of a line is

y-y_1=m(x-x_1)

Where, m is the slope.

The slope of perpendicular line is -\dfrac{1}{3} and it passes through the point (9,5). So the equation of the line is

y-5=-\dfrac{1}{3}(x-9)

y-5=-\dfrac{1}{3}(x)-\dfrac{1}{3}(-9)

y-5=-\dfrac{1}{3}x+3

Adding 5 on both sides, we get

y-5+5=-\dfrac{1}{3}x+3+5

y=-\dfrac{1}{3}x+8

Therefore, the equation of required line is y=-\dfrac{1}{3}x+8.
